首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Angular js (1.4)在ng-repeat中使用三元运算符来显示不同的html?

AngularJS是一种流行的前端开发框架,它提供了丰富的功能和工具来简化Web应用程序的开发过程。AngularJS的一个重要特性是数据绑定,它允许开发人员将数据模型与视图进行关联,实现实时更新和交互。

在AngularJS中,ng-repeat指令用于在HTML模板中循环显示一组数据。使用三元运算符来根据条件显示不同的HTML是完全可行的。

下面是一个示例,演示了如何在ng-repeat中使用三元运算符来显示不同的HTML:

代码语言:txt
复制
<div ng-repeat="item in items">
  <div ng-if="item.type === 'A'">
    <p>This is type A</p>
  </div>
  <div ng-if="item.type === 'B'">
    <p>This is type B</p>
  </div>
  <div ng-if="item.type === 'C'">
    <p>This is type C</p>
  </div>
</div>

在上面的示例中,ng-repeat指令循环遍历名为items的数组,并为每个数组项创建一个作用域。在每个作用域中,我们使用ng-if指令来根据item的type属性的值来决定显示哪个HTML块。

这种方法可以用于根据不同的条件显示不同的HTML内容。在实际应用中,您可以根据具体需求和数据模型的属性来自定义条件和HTML内容。

对于AngularJS的更多信息和学习资源,您可以访问腾讯云的AngularJS产品介绍页面:AngularJS产品介绍

相关搜索:如何使用三元运算符来显示不同位置的Reactjs中的不同元素如何使用Angular JS在单行中显示不同的图像?使用angular js在html中显示json嵌套对象的数据。如何使用Laravel 5.7中的三元运算符在Brade的{{}}中呈现HTML?使用三元运算符(Angular.Js 1.x)的ng类中的fa图标?Vue.js -如何使用三元运算符在vue中返回带有可怕字体图标的html在Angular JS中的html中显示时,从数字中移除符号无法使用*ngFor在Angular中单行显示不同的Mat-cardsAngular 5:如何使用相同的指令来限制输入字段并在html的标签中显示文本让JS (mouseover,mouseleave)在html文档中的图片上显示不同的文本在使用&&,||或三元运算符时,有没有更漂亮的设置来防止自动将React组件包装在括号中?在angular 6应用程序中,可以使用Is矩来检测网页中显示的时间的dst使用node.js在MySQL的HTML表单中显示默认值使用css和js在html中显示带有onClick事件的隐藏内容如何使用Angular JS在每个列中分别过滤html表中的数据?使用节点js/javascript在HTML表中显示SQL数据库中的数据使用Django在一个html表格中显示来自两个不同模型的数据。我可以使用Angular JS在某些条件下(没有任何引导服务)在控制器中使用HTML中的调用属性来控制模式吗?如何使用d3.js在点击piechart切片后将数据发送到Angular中的html如何使用API从数据库中获取数组图像并将其转换为JSON数组以在Angular 4中的HTML中显示
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券